WebEnzymes are commonly named by adding a suffix “-ase” to the root name of the substrate molecule they will naturally be acting upon. For example, Lipase catalyzes the hydrolysis of lipids, they break down the molecule with the help of water; Sucrase catalyzes the hydrolysis of sucrose into glucose and fructose. WebWhen substrates are added to the medium, they bind to the active sites present on the enzyme based on their specificity using non-covalent interactions. This binding on the enzyme with the substrates forms an intermediate complex known as the Enzyme-substrate complex. The substrates are broken down into the products at the active site. WebDigestive enzymes all belong to the hydrolase class, and their action is one of splitting up large food molecules into their ‘building block’ components. Another unique property is that they are extracellular enzymes that mix with food as it passes through the gut. The majority of other enzymes function within the cytoplasm of the cell. WebEnzymes and activation energy A substance that speeds up a chemical reaction—without being a reactant—is called a catalyst. The catalysts for biochemical reactions that happen in living organisms are called enzymes. Enzymes are usually proteins, though some ribonucleic acid (RNA) molecules act as enzymes too.

WebThe three main protease enzymes are trypsin, pepsin, and chymotrypsin. Special cells produce an enzyme, called pepsinogen in your stomach that converts into pepsin when it comes in contact with the acid surrounding the stomach.
